Web9 jan. 2024 · 6. Simply taping the wires or installing wire nuts would be safe for the short term, where no tampering was likely. Should not be done in a situation where children or pets can access the wires. The only "legal" way to fix things is to install a blank plate over the fixture box or whatever, after installing the wire nuts. – Hot Licks.
